Just a few weeks ago it was rumoured that 1989's Batman himself, Michael Keaton, was in talks to play the lead villain role in the upcoming Marvel Cinematic Universe reboot of Spider-Man, titled Spider-Man: Homecoming. After that news got out, the rumour was put to sleep and nothing came out about it. Some said the negotiations fell through.......UNTIL NOW!!!
Today, word has got out that Mr Keaton, star of the critically acclaimed film, Birdman, is said to be in final talks to playing the main villain, wether it be The Vulture, as previously speculated OR......the MCU version of Norman Osborn, who will, as we all know, will at some point transform into The Green Goblin. The character of Vulture was on the cards as a main villain waaaaaaay back when Sam Raimi was in charge of the Spidey franchise. He wanted him as the lead villain for Spider-Man 4 and was to be played by the great John Malkovich.
The Vulture is an interesting character, as long as he's done right and not just a version of The Green Goblin, with wings. This, I am looking forward to.

FN-2187 Set To Join The Cast Of Black Panther?
John Boyega aka everyone's favourite Stormtrooper who said fuck you to The First Order, Finn, is the latest name on the cards to join Chadwick Boseman aka Black Panther in his first solo outing in the MCU in 2018.
It's unknown what role Boyega is up for, wether it's good or bad, but he's joining an amazingly growing cast of black American actors such as Michael B Jordan (Fantastic Four's Human Torch) and Lupita Nyong'o (Star Wars - The Force Awakens's Maz).
Rise & Dawn Of The Planet Of The Apes star and Mo-Cap expert, Andy Serkis, is rumoured to be returning to the role of Ulysses Klaue aka Klaw, a character that was introduced in 2015's Avengers - Age Of Ultron.

True Detective Star Joins Marvel's Doctor Strange!
Rachel McAdams is the latest actor/actress to be confirmed to join the highly anticipated Doctor Strange movie for Marvel and Disney's MCU. She will be joining Sherlock Holmes himself, Benedict Cumberbatch, who will be playing the title role of Doctor Stephen Strange.
There is no word as of yet which role she will be taking on in the 14th film in the Marvel Cinematic Universe. Word is that she will be playing Clea, who is Strange's lover in the comic book series.

Josh Brolin Has Been Cast As The Voice Of Thanos In The MCU!
Thanos was first seen at the end of 2012's "Avengers Assemble", played by Damion Poitier. He was real and made up with prosthetic make-up, but it's been rumoured that Brolin's full incarnation of the character will be CGI with only Brolin's voice being used to bring the rest of the villain to life.

Paul Rudd Cast As Ant-Man And Michael Douglas Cast As Hank Pym!
"Anchorman" star and all out Hollywood funny man, Paul Rudd and well, just fucking Michael Douglas, have both been cast in Edgar Wright's 2015 entry into the Marvel Cinematic Universe, "Ant-Man". Rudd has been cast as the films leading superhero, but it's unknown which version of Ant-Man he'll play seeing as Douglas has been cast as an aged Hank Pym. It's assumed that Rudd will be playing Scott Lang's Ant-Man.
Douglas as mentioned that he's been dying for a role in a Marvel Comics film, or in fact, any sort of comic book film to be honest. The film's director and co-writter, Edgar Wright has said that we will see Douglas's Pym in action at the beginning of the film back in the 60's and then the story will fast forward to Scott Lang's story in the present day.

COMIC-CON: "Avengers 2" Get's Official Title!
Whilst at COMIC-CON, "Avengers" director and GEEK genius Joss Whedon confirmed that his 2015 "Avengers" sequel will be called "Avengers: Age Of Ultron". It's called this because classic comic book villain Ultron will be the films lead villain before it's assumed Thanos will take on Earth's Mightiest Heroes in the third film.
On the note of Thanos, he's been confirmed to show up in next years "Guardians Of The Galaxy". It's not been confirmed if he's one of the lead villains or if he's just showing up to make himself known again.

Quicksilver and Scarlet Witch In "Avengers 2" And Quicksilver In "X-Men: Days Of Future Past" Too!
So both Bryan "X-Men: Days Of Future Past" Singer and Joss "Avengers 2" Whedon have confirmed that they are planning to have Quicksilver in both their superhero films. Singer and Fox have found their actor for their Quicksilver whereas Whedon and Marvel haven't. "America Horror Story" actor Evan Peters will be playing Quicksilver in "Days Of Future Past". "Kick-Ass" star Aaron Taylor-Johnson is rumoured to take on the role of Whedon's Quicksilver, but nothing has been confirmed. Whedon also plans to have Silvers twin sister Scarlet Witch in his "Avengers" sequel also along with Quicksilver.
"Guardians Of The Galaxy" Latest Casting!
Benicio Del Toro, Karen Gillan and Glenn Close are the latest set of actors to join the still growing cast of James Gunn's 2014 "Guardians Of The Galaxy" live action film. Gillan is playing the lead female villain, but it's not yet confirmed who that may be. Del Toro is playing secondary villain, Taneleer Tivan and finally Close is playing a leader type character at the Nova Corp.
